After that, if you still have no access to Internet, you need to check if the Access Point Name (APN) is properly configured on your device. To do that on your iPhone/iPad, go to :
– Settings:
– Then select Mobile Data:
– Then, in Cellular Plan, select the Ubigi eSIM (“secondary” plan):
– After that, select Mobile data network:
– Finally, in the APN field, make sure that mbb is specified (if not, type it in the field):
You can now connect to the Internet through the connectivity of your Ubigi eSIM.

How to check eSIM compatibility
Smartphones / Tablets:
Dial *#06#. → If an EID number appears, your device is eSIM-compatible.
Windows 10 / 11:
Press Windows+I. Go to “Network & Internet” → If you see "Cellular", your PC is eSIM-compatible.
How to check carrier unlocking
iPhone / iPad:
Go to Settings > General > About. Scroll to Carrier Lock. → If you see “No SIM restrictions”, your device is unlocked.
Android:
Go to Settings > Network & Internet > Mobile network. Disable Automatic network selection. → If multiple networks appear, your device is unlocked.
